Worth knowing

State income tax is what separates these two states

Of everything that changes when you move from Florida to Arizona, state income tax moves the most: about $149 a month more, which is most of the whole difference.

Florida vs Arizona at a glance

 FloridaArizona
Median home price$359,000$394,500
Median rent$1,669/mo$1,543/mo
State income taxNo state income taxFlat 2.50%
Property tax rate0.76%0.48%
Groceries, gas & goods9895
Utilities9092

Price levels are indexes where 100 is the national average. They cover everyday spending only; housing is the two rows above.

What the move itself costs

$3,600 to $7,800

From a container you load yourself up to full-service movers.

Shipping one car adds about $1,000 to $1,450, against roughly $800 in fuel and lodging to drive it the 5-day trip yourself.

These are statewide figures. Miami is not Florida-average and Phoenix is not Arizona-average, so a specific city can look nothing like its state. Compare metro areas instead to narrow it to 387 real places, including which side of a state line you would live on.
